Da·man D0015100 (də-män′) A former Portuguese colony of northwest India on the eastern shore of the Gulf of Khambhat. It was acquired by the Portuguese in 1539 and annexed by India in 1962. daman (ˈdæmən) n (Animals) a rare name for the hyrax, esp the Syrian rock hyrax. See hyrax See also cony2[from Arabic damān Isrā'īl sheep of Israel]
Daman (dɑːˈmɑːn) n (Placename) a coastal town in W India, the chief town of Daman and Diu. Pop: 35 743 (2001).
